Motgaon

Motgaon is a village located in Dahanu tehsil of Thane district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 15km away from sub-district headquarter Dahanu (tehsildar office) and 100km away from district headquarter Thane. As per 2009 stats, Asangaon B is the gram panchayat of Motgaon village.

About Motgaon

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Motgaon is 551725. The village spans a total geographical area of 2001 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 401103. Dahanu is nearest town to Motgaon village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 15km away.

Population of Motgaon

Below is a concise population overview of Motgaon as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 1,199 591 608
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 114 51 63
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 11 5 6
Literate Population 778 456 322
Illiterate Population 421 135 286

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Motgaon village:

  • The total population of Motgaon village is around 1,199, including approximately 591 males and 608 females, with a sex ratio of 1028 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 114 children aged 0–6 years in Motgaon village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Motgaon village has 11 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Motgaon village is about 64.89%, with male literacy at 77.16% and female literacy at 52.96%.
  • There are around 265 households in Motgaon village.

Connectivity of Motgaon

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Motgaon. As per the 2011 stats, Motgaon had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
